Abstract
Three “identical” haploid genomes (N = 22; 10M 12m) comprise the 3n = 66 (30M 36m) karyotype in the parthenogenetic gymnophthalmid lizard Leposoma percarinatum from Brazil. A hybridization event between a bisexual and a diploid unisexual species might explain the origin of L. percarinatum.
